Hearing Care Professional - Oneota, NY & Norwich, NY
Sign-On Bonus: $5,000
Salary: $60,000-$80,000 Sales Incentive Plan
Alpaca Audiology is looking for an energetic, compassionate Audiologist, Licensed Hearing Aid Dispenser, or 4th Year Extern who wants to be a part of the fastest growing private Audiology Care group in the USA.
This opportunity is for a Hearing Care Provider to work in our Oneonta and/or Norwich, NY locations.
We pride ourselves on providing high quality, comprehensive services to our patients with the approach of treating every patient as an individual. We have an elite leadership team who will provide all the necessary tools to ensure your success. We offer access to the industry's leading equipment and technology to help our providers deliver the highest quality care available to their patients.
The ideal candidate must be strong clinically and willing to work with the leading hearing aid manufacturers. We are looking for someone who can work independently who excels in building patient rapport and has dispensing/closing skills. They will be responsible for the daily audiological tasks as well as performing in community outreach projects and working with the Alpaca Audiology team to ensure the success of their clinic.
Essential Functions:
Perform patient hearing test assessments; analyze results and recommend varied treatment and product options
Address patient's questions and concerns regarding benefits of Hearing Aid use
Discuss pricing of hearing instruments, presenting the value of hearing health care, your services, and the long-term effects of hearing aid use
Community outreach efforts to generate new patient referrals
Teach patients how to best utilize the new technology to meet their hearing goals
Hearing aid repairs, checks, and cleanings.
Perform needed adjustments to fitted products; comply with all procedural company quality standards and guidelines to maximize product performance and overcome patient concerns/objections.
With direct support of clinic staff, ensure smooth office operations
Qualifications/Requirements
Hearing Aid Dispensing License in the state of New York
Doctorate in Audiology preferred
3rd and 4th year Audiology Externs encouraged to apply
Benefits:
Medical, dental, vision benefits
401k 3% match
PTO Paid Holidays
Student loan repayment for Audiologists
CEU and licensing reimbursement
100% free hearing aids for all employees

About Sonova

Over 20% of the worlds adult population is affected by hearing loss. At Sonova, we consider this number to be too high, and envision a world where everyone enjoys the delight of hearing and therefore lives a life without limitations. Since the foundation of our company in 1947, we have been on a mission to become the recognized innovation leader in the global hearing care market. We are committed to offering the most comprehensive solutions from hearing aids to cochlear implants to wireless communication solutions to treat all forms of hearing loss and improve quality of life, as well as mas ... ter the most challenging hearing situations. Our brands Phonak, Unitron, Hansaton, Advanced Bionics and AudioNova cover the entire hearing spectrum. With a presence in over 100 countries and a workforce of over 14,000 dedicated employees, we leverage our global infrastructure and local roots. We aim for a work environment and culture that fosters a good balance of family and work life for both men and women. We are therefore pleased that 39% of our management positions are filled by women and that 63.5% of our employees are female. Furthermore, 45% of our employees belong to Generation Y (born between 1979 and 1994). By supporting the Hear the World Foundation, Sonova pursues its vision of a world where everyone enjoys the delight of hearing and therefore lives a life without limitations.
